A <italic toggle="yes">Clostridium difficile</italic>-Specific, Gel-Forming Protein Required for Optimal Spore Germination

ABSTRACT Clostridium difficile is a Gram-positive spore-forming obligate anaerobe that is a leading cause of antibiotic-associated diarrhea worldwide.
